The Role

Maynooth University is committed to a strategy in which the primary University goals of excellent research and scholarship and outstanding education are interlinked and equally valued.

We are seeking an excellent academic to join our staff as an Assistant Professor/Lecturer in the Department of Electronic Engineering (EE). The individual selected for the position should possess a demonstrated track record in teaching, research and publication or equivalent relevant industry experience that aligns with their career stage. They will be expected to make a strong contribution to the teaching programme of the Masters in Integrated Design in Maynooth University. Teaching duties will primarily involve postgraduate programs, along with active involvement in supervisory roles for master's and PhD students.

This position is open to applicants of all disciplines within the field of electronic engineering, but we would welcome applicants with expertise in the areas of integrated circuit design (digital, analog, mixed signal), IC verification, artificial intelligence & machine learning, signal processing, hardware programming languages and digital systems, computing and programming etc. The successful candidate will play a key role in the development and enhancement of a European pedagogical approach to the delivery of the academic curriculum in the MEngSc.

The successful appointee will be expected to sustain and conduct research, engage in scholarship of quality and substance, and generate publications of an international standard. They will be expected to build a strong research profile, that supports Maynooth university’s research strategy including affiliating to its research institutes where appropriate and working with colleagues on national and international research projects. They will also be expected to seek and, where feasible, facilitate links between research activities in Maynooth University and Industry.

Principal Duties

Teaching:

Masters level postgraduate teaching duties are assigned by the Head of the Department of Electronic Engineering in Maynooth University. These duties will include:

Teaching and assessing students at postgraduate level. This may include lecturing, tutoring, leading practical learning activities, project supervision, and setting, supervising and grading assessments;
